Ich benutze Linux seit über einem Jahr und hatte nie nennenswerte Probleme damit. Doch seit kurzem habe ich das Problem, daß ich unter KDE (V 1.1.2) keine Programme mehr starten kann, wenn ich gerade online bin. Auf der Textkonsole, von der ich KDE gestartet habe, erscheint dann folgende Meldung:
AUDIT: Sat Apr 7 12:38:46 2001: 756 X: client 11 rejected from local host Xlib: connection to ":0.0" refused by server Xlib: Client is not authorized to connect to Server kioslave: cannot connect to X server :0
Bemerkenswert ist, daß diese Meldung weder in /var/log/messages noch in ~/.xsession-errors auftaucht, sondern nur auf die Textkonsole geschrieben wird (umschalten mit CONTROL+ALT+F12 und dann mit ALT+F1 zur Konsole 1 wechseln, zum Grafikbildschirm zurück geht's mit ALT+F8)
Dazu muß ich auch noch sagen, daß alles funktionierte, bis ich OPERA installiert hatte (tar.gz Archiv). OPERA habe ich am gleichen Tag aber wieder gelöscht, weil es nicht lief (einige lib's waren zu alt). Außerdem hab ich am gleichen Tag noch einige RPM's gelöscht, bei denen ich der Meinung war, daß ich sie nicht brauche. Die RPM's habe ich inzwischen wieder nach bestem Wissen installiert, aber ohne Erfolg.
Ich hoffe ihr könnt mit diesen Angaben etwas anfangen.
Ich benutze übrigens Caldera OpenLinux 2.3 und wenn ich offline bin, geht alles wie immer.
Alexander
On Sat, Apr 07, 2001 at 12:57:17PM +0200, Alexander Gappisch wrote:
Ich benutze Linux seit über einem Jahr und hatte nie nennenswerte Probleme damit. Doch seit kurzem habe ich das Problem, daß ich unter KDE (V 1.1.2) keine Programme mehr starten kann, wenn ich gerade online bin. Auf der Textkonsole, von der ich KDE gestartet habe, erscheint dann folgende Meldung:
AUDIT: Sat Apr 7 12:38:46 2001: 756 X: client 11 rejected from local host Xlib: connection to ":0.0" refused by server Xlib: Client is not authorized to connect to Server kioslave: cannot connect to X server :0
Schau mal nach, ob in deinem Homeverzeichnis die Datei .Xauthority vorhanden ist. Dort wird das Magic-Cookies deines X-Servers drinn gespeichert. Wenn diese Datei leer ist, können sich deine Programme nicht ordnungsgemäß beim Server anmelden und werden beendet.
Bemerkenswert ist, daß diese Meldung weder in /var/log/messages noch in ~/.xsession-errors auftaucht, sondern nur auf die Textkonsole geschrieben wird
Diese Fehlermeldung wird von den Programmen auf STDERR ausgegeben, was normaler auf deine Konsole umgelenkt wird. Von daher ist alles in Ordnung.
Dazu muß ich auch noch sagen, daß alles funktionierte
[...] Ich wüsste auch nicht woran es genau liegen könnte, aber benutzt du xdm/kdm?
Ciao, Tobias
Hi Tobias,
Schau mal nach, ob in deinem Homeverzeichnis die Datei .Xauthority vorhanden ist. Dort wird das Magic-Cookies deines X-Servers drinn gespeichert. Wenn diese Datei leer ist, können sich deine Programme nicht ordnungsgemäß beim Server anmelden und werden beendet.
Ja, die .Xauthority hatte ich auch als erstes im verdacht - scheint aber in Ordnung zu sein.
Ich wüsste auch nicht woran es genau liegen könnte, aber benutzt du xdm/kdm?
Nein, ich starte den Rechner noch ganz altmodisch im Textmodus, KDE benutze ich nur fürs Internet.
Ich hab auch schon probeweise die Datei in .Xauthority.old umbenannt und dann X gestartet - dabei wird die Datei dann neu erzeugt.
Auch das Anlegen eines ganz neuen Account's hat nichts gebracht.
Außerdem ist mir schleierhaft, warum alles geht, wenn ich offline bin %^)
Alexander
Ich hab's gefunden!
kppp hat eine Option - Zugang bearbeiten / IP:
-Konfiguriere Hostnamen automatisch von dieser IP
diese Option hab ich wohl irgendwann mal aktiviert.
Tja, wenn der Rechner plötzlich einen anderen Namen hat, wenn man online ist, dann wird's natürlich nischt mit der Authorisation beim X-Server.
Danke trotzdem Alexander
On Sunday 08 April 2001 14:59, Alexander Gappisch wrote:
Hi Tobias,
Schau mal nach, ob in deinem Homeverzeichnis die Datei .Xauthority vorhanden ist. Dort wird das Magic-Cookies deines X-Servers drinn gespeichert. Wenn diese Datei leer ist, können sich deine Programme nicht ordnungsgemäß beim Server anmelden und werden beendet.
Ja, die .Xauthority hatte ich auch als erstes im verdacht - scheint aber in Ordnung zu sein.
mach mal vorher "xhost +" wenn es danach immernoch auftritt ist es ein echtes Problem. ;-)
Konrad
lug-dd@mailman.schlittermann.de